In these results, air and ether vapour were drawn by a pump through
the material to imitate the inspiration, but no attempt seems to have
been made to imitate expiration. The effect upon the material used of
moisture condensed from the expired air is not taken into account
in these experiments. This is a serious hiatus in the argument,
particularly as regards lint. This material in actual use rapidly
becomes quite sodden, and ether will not vaporise from it properly.
In spite of this fault, these observations may probably be taken as
being reasonably accurate.
With them may be compared the figures of Karl Connell, who, working
with quite accurate methods, estimated the percentages of ether
necessary to induce and maintain anæsthesia:--
Period of Anæsthesia. Percentage.
First 5 minutes (_i.e._ induction) 18
Next 25 „ 14
Next 30 „ 12
Next 60 „ 12·8
“Bad” subjects on the average required an extra 4 per cent. during
first half hour, feeble patients required 2 per cent. less.
(_Journal_ of the American Medical Association, 22nd March 1913).
APPENDIX III.
THE ACTION OF ANÆSTHETICS UPON THE BLOOD.
_The Blood Gases in Anæsthesia._
Buckmaster and Gardner (_Journal of Physiology_, vol. xli., p. 246),
analysed the blood gases in various stages of chloroform anæsthesia,
and some of their results are shown below in tabular form. They show a
very definite reduction in the oxygen content of the blood. So far as
one gathers from the text of the paper, the animals were not subjected
to any considerable trauma during the progress of the anæsthesia, so
that the figures arrived at with regard to the CO_{2} content do not
bear upon the Acapnia question. If there was no trauma, there would be
no deep breathing, and a reduction of CO_{2} could not be expected.
